Definitionen

simultaneousadjektiv
Occurring, operating, or done at the same time.
The simultaneous translation of the speech allowed everyone to understand it in their own language.
Mathematics: (of equations) involving the same set of unknowns and intended to be solved together.
The students tackled the simultaneous equations during the algebra class.
simultaneoussubstantiv
A chess exhibition in which a strong player plays multiple games at the same time against different opponents.
The grandmaster gave a simultaneous last night, facing twenty club players at once.
